Popular Neighborhoods in Dakar

Downtown Dakar

Downtown Dakar is the heart of the city and offers a mix of residential and commercial properties. It is a vibrant area with many restaurants, cafes, and shops. Apartments in downtown Dakar are ideal for those who want to be in the center of the action.

Almadies

Almadies is a popular neighborhood known for its stunning ocean views and beautiful beaches. It is a more upscale area with luxury apartments and villas. If you enjoy a peaceful and scenic environment, Almadies might be the perfect neighborhood for you.

Plateau

The Plateau neighborhood is the central business district of Dakar. It is home to many government buildings, banks, and international organizations. Apartments in the Plateau are convenient for professionals working in the area or those who prefer a more urban lifestyle.

Setting Your Budget

Calculating Your Rental Budget

Before starting your apartment search, it is essential to determine how much you can afford to spend on rent. A general rule of thumb is that your monthly rent should not exceed 30% of your monthly income. Calculate your monthly income and expenses to understand your financial capacity.

Additional Costs to Consider

When setting your budget, remember to take into account additional costs such as utilities, parking fees, and maintenance fees. Some apartments may include these costs in the rental price, while others may require you to pay them separately.
